I move Australian Greens amendment (7) on sheet 5636:

(7)    Clause 10, page 5 (after line 13), after subclause (5), insert:

     (5A)    If a person is required to attend before the Independent Reviewer under subsection (5), the Independent Reviewer may:

             (a)    require the person, before answering questions, either to take an oath or to make an affirmation in a form approved by the Independent Reviewer; and

             (b)    administer an oath or affirmation to the person.

We are seeking here to amend the original bill to empower the independent reviewer to require people to take an oath or an affirmation before providing information relevant to the reviews.
